Kinds of Headphones
When looking for headphones, it is necessary to understand the different types available in the market. Below is a summary of the primary classifications:
1. Over-Ear HeadphonesDescription: These headphones cover the entire ear, frequently supplying excellent sound seclusion and comfort.Best For: Home listening and studio work.2. On-Ear HeadphonesDescription: On-ear headphones rest on the external ear. They tend to be more portable than over-ear designs however may not provide as much noise seclusion.Best For: Casual listening and travel.3. In-Ear Headphones (Earbuds)Description: These fit directly in the ear canal and are extremely portable. They provide differing sound quality and sound isolation depending on the model.Best For: On-the-go listening and exercising.4. Wireless HeadphonesDescription: These do not have physical wires, typically linking by means of Bluetooth technology. Lots of designs likewise include noise-cancellation innovation.Best For: Movement during exercises or commuting.5. Noise-Cancelling HeadphonesDescription: These headphones actively shut out ambient noise, making them ideal for noisy environments.Best For: Travel and focused listening.6. Video gaming HeadsetsDescription: Designed for video gaming, these often featured an integrated microphone and noise functions customized for immersive gameplay.Best For: Gamers who want an one-upmanship.7. When selecting headphones, consumers ought to focus on different features that affect their listening experience. Below are crucial features to think about:
Sound Quality
Look for headphones that provide a balanced noise profile ideal for your music preferences.
Convenience
Think about ear padding, weight, and design, specifically for long listening sessions.
Battery Life
For wireless headphones, battery life can considerably affect functionality. Look for designs with a minimum of 20+ hours of playback.
Connectivity
Identify whether you require wired, wireless, or both kinds of connection.
Sound Isolation
Examine your requirement for passive or active sound cancellation based upon your environment.
Resilience
Try to find robust building and construction if you prepare on using headphones during activities or commuting.
Portability

Are wired headphones better than wireless ones?
Wired headphones typically provide much better sound quality and low latency, while wireless headphones provide convenience and mobility. The option depends upon personal preference and particular use cases.
2. Is noise cancellation worth it?
Noise cancellation can considerably enhance the listening experience, particularly in noisy environments. If you often find yourself in crowded locations or taking a trip, buying noise-cancelling headphones can be advantageous.
3. How do I preserve my headphones?
To maintain headphones, clean them routinely, prevent exposing them to moisture, store them safely, and avoid twisting wires (for wired models).
